The Nike Zoom Rival Multi Trainers are designed for adult track athletes looking for a versatile shoe that can handle a variety of training events. Its primary strength lies in a specialized spike plate that balances high-traction speed work with the flexibility required for endurance or varied technical sessions, though the performance-focused design is less suited for long-distance road running or casual everyday wear.

FAQs

Can I use these for road running?

No, these trainers are designed specifically for synthetic track surfaces. The spike plate will not provide comfort or protection on hard road surfaces.

Are these shoes suitable for beginners?

Yes, their multi-event design makes them an excellent choice for track athletes who are still exploring different event disciplines.

How do I know when to replace the pins?

If the spikes appear significantly worn down, flattened, or rusted, you should replace them to maintain optimal grip.

What is the best way to clean the mesh?

Use a soft, damp cloth with mild soap to spot-clean the mesh uppers, then allow them to air dry.

Are these true to size?

Nike track shoes typically feature a snug, performance-oriented fit. If you prefer extra room, consider ordering a half-size up.

Troubleshooting

Spike pins keep coming loose

Ensure the threads are clean of debris and use a spike wrench to tighten them securely before every track session.

Outsole showing premature wear

Verify that you are using the shoes primarily on synthetic track surfaces and avoid walking on concrete or asphalt, which accelerates outsole degradation.

Setup, Compatibility & Care

To ensure peak performance, check that your spikes are tightly secured before each session using a standard spike wrench. These shoes are compatible with standard track spike pins; replace pins when they show signs of thinning or blunting. After training, clean the outsole by gently brushing off loose debris and track rubber with a soft-bristled brush. Avoid submerging the shoes in water; if the mesh uppers become wet, air dry them naturally away from direct heat sources to prevent material degradation.
